A little about Torrington Silver Band
We’ve been in existence for over fifty years, and whether we’re taking part in national competitions, playing in local carnivals or holding concerts, our combination of fun, enthusiasm and hard work shine through for all to enjoy.

We welcome experienced players, but equally welcome are those who want to come and learn. We have a thriving junior section consisting of both children and adults, and when you're good enough, you can graduate as a fully-fledged member of the senior band.
If rhythm is more your thing, we have a thriving corp of drums, of which we are very proud. We are unique in the region for having such a drum section, and they are always an attraction at concerts, carnivals and other events.
Living in such a wonderful town enables us to take part in some fantastic local events. Every year, the band are an important part of the May Fair festivities. The twinning of Torrington with Roscoff, France, has made for some memorable trips to Brittany in the past and every other year we look forward to welcoming our French visitors, entertaining them at various twinning events.
